John Wallowitch, a multifaceted individual, entered this world on February 11, 1926, in the vibrant city of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, United States of America.
Throughout his life, he made a name for himself as a talented actor, leaving a lasting impact on the film industry with his memorable performances in notable productions such as Blood, released in 1973, Stars and the Moon: Betty Buckley Live at the Donmar, a 2002 live performance, and The Cosby Mysteries, a 1994 television series.
Sadly, John Wallowitch's life came to a close on August 15, 2007, in Bronx, New York City, New York, United States of America.
